Oz Lotto Pattern Overview

The most common odd/even split in Oz Lotto is 3 even, 4 odd, and the most typical low/high distribution is 4L-3H. The average sum of a winning combination is 162, with numbers spread across an average range of 35.0 between the lowest and highest number drawn.

Understanding Oz Lotto Draw Patterns

Draw pattern analysis examines the structural characteristics of winning combinations beyond individual number frequency. For Oz Lotto, we track whether draws tend to favor odd or even numbers, low or high numbers, and whether consecutive numbers appear.

Odd/Even Balance

Most winning draws show a balanced mix of odd and even numbers. A purely odd or purely even ticket is statistically less common.

High/Low Spread

Winning combinations typically include a spread of both low numbers (below midpoint) and high numbers (above midpoint) rather than clustering at one end.

Sum Distribution

The sum of winning numbers follows a bell curve distribution. Combinations with sums at the extremes are statistically rare.

Frequently Asked Questions

What does the odd/even pattern mean in Oz Lotto?

The odd/even pattern shows how many odd vs even numbers appear in each draw. For example, "3 even, 3 odd" means exactly 3 even and 3 odd numbers were drawn. Analyzing which patterns appear most often can guide your number selection strategy.

What are low and high numbers?

Low numbers are those in the bottom half of the number range (e.g., 1–23 for a 1-47 game). High numbers are in the top half. Most draws include a mix of both.

How should I use the sum distribution chart?

The bell curve shows that most Oz Lotto winning combinations have sums near the middle of the possible range. Choosing numbers whose sum falls near the peak of the bell curve means your combination statistically resembles typical winning draws.

What does 'consecutive count' mean?

Consecutive count shows how many consecutive numbers appear in a draw (e.g., 12 and 13 are consecutive). Most draws have 0 or 1 pair of consecutive numbers; having 3 or more is relatively rare.
